Napoleon and Francois II after the Battle of Austerlitz, a Viennese glass beaker, Fürchtegott Leberecht Fischer, circa 1900 Crystal glass flashed with yellow coloured glass in places and golden decoration. The front bears a transparent enamel painting showing the meeting between Napoleon and the Austrian Emperor Franz II on 4 December 1805 at Nasiedlowitz, signed, "F.L.F. pinx" at the lower left above the title and date, "4 décembre 1805."
